Finnish Prime Minister Matti Vanhanen is poised to try to defuse a trade row between Warsaw and Moscow that is holding up negotiations on a crucial European Union deal with Russia. Vanhanen, whose country holds the rotating presidency of the 25-nation EU, was scheduled to hold talks in Warsaw on Friday evening with his Polish counterpart Jaroslaw Kaczynski. Full Story
